G7 Summit Insights: Challenges and Opportunities
This chapter explores the significance of the G7 summit in Cornwall, marking Joe Biden's first overseas trip as president. It discusses various pressing global issues on the agenda, including climate change and pandemic response, while examining the shifting dynamics of the G7's role in international policymaking. Additionally, the chapter emphasizes the need for the G7 to unite and adapt to effectively address contemporary challenges, including corporate taxation and vaccine distribution.
